Abstract :
In this paper, we propose and discuss an array-grating compressor that is used in high power chirped-pulse amplification Nd:glass laser systems. Theoretical models including various angular errors are developed for the optical design of the array-grating compressor. With a criterion that the stretch in the duration of the compressed pulse due to the combining imperfection must be kept below 25%, we carry out the optical design of the array-grating compressor for a 0.5 ps pulse duration and a 1-m laser-beam diameter. The limitations to groove-width difference, parallelism, and planar are also discussed.
